The rule is that the exterior angle (ACD) is equal to the sum of the remote interior angles (the two marked angles on the right).
You are expected to use this relation to write and solve an equation.
exterior angle = angle D + angle B
(2x +16) = 58 + (x+12)
2x +16 = x +70
x + 16 = 70
x = 54
Then angle ACD is ...
angle ACD = (2x +16)° = (2·54 +16)°
angle ACD = 124°
